Central locking wouldn't work, but door opened with key manually. Car then wouldn't start and was showing hazard lights flashing on dash but not the actual lights themselves.
Anyone got any ideas what the problem could be>
-
Try disconnecting the battery for 10 minutes (or is it 30?).
That should reset your smart box. It sounds to me like it got into a confused state to do with the car being opened without the immobiliser resetting.
